Top locations to stay in Des Moines

Some of the best areas to stay in Des Moines, Iowa, are Downtown Des Moines, Historic East Village, and the Court District. Downtown Des Moines offers a vibrant atmosphere with excellent transport links and stunning city views. Historic East Village is known for its charm and unique shops, while the Court District is lively with dining and entertainment. For first-time visitors, Downtown Des Moines is the most convenient choice.

  1. Downtown Des MoinesOpens in a new window: Staying in Downtown Des Moines places you right in the heart of the city, where you can easily explore a vibrant mix of shopping, dining, and cultural attractions. This area is known for its lively atmosphere, with an array of shops, art galleries, and theaters. You can enjoy a stroll along the scenic riverfront or catch a performance at a local venue. It’s also home to some of the city’s best events and festivals, making it a hub of activity throughout the year.
  2. Historic East VillageOpens in a new window: This charming neighbourhood offers a unique blend of history and modernity, making it an attractive place to stay. The Historic East Village is filled with boutique shops, local artisans, and a vibrant arts scene. You can explore the area's rich history while enjoying trendy cafés and cultural spots. It's a great location for those who appreciate a more relaxed vibe with easy access to downtown attractions.
  3. Court DistrictOpens in a new window: The Court District is a hidden gem in Des Moines, featuring a mix of cultural attractions and a lively atmosphere. Known for its art galleries and theatres, this area caters to those looking to immerse themselves in the local arts scene. With trendy bars and eateries nearby, it’s a fantastic spot for evening outings. The district often hosts events that showcase local talent, giving visitors a taste of the city’s creative spirit.

Things to do in Des Moines

Des Moines offers a vibrant blend of sports excitement, captivating live music, and lively festivals, making it an ideal spot for a city break. Enjoy thrilling basketball games, attend dynamic theatre performances, or explore scenic parks for a bit of hiking. This charming city promises an unforgettable experience for every traveller.

  • Iowa State Capitol BuildingOpens in a new window – Step inside this stunning historic civic building, where you can admire the magnificent golden dome and intricate architecture. Take a guided tour to uncover fascinating stories about Iowa’s government and its rich history while exploring the beautifully decorated interiors.
  • AdventurelandOpens in a new window – Thrill-seekers will love the excitement at this amusement park, packed with roller coasters, water rides, and family-friendly attractions. Spend the day enjoying exhilarating rides, live entertainment, and delicious fair food that will keep the whole family smiling.
  • Iowa State FairgroundsOpens in a new window – Visit the iconic fairgrounds, where you can experience the vibrant atmosphere of the famous Iowa State Fair, held every August. Enjoy live music, savour mouth-watering local delicacies, and explore a variety of exhibits showcasing Iowa's agricultural heritage throughout the year.
  • Des Moines Civic CenterOpens in a new window – Catch a captivating performance at this premier arts venue, where you can enjoy everything from Broadway shows to concerts. The striking architecture and welcoming atmosphere make it a perfect spot to appreciate the local arts scene.

Best time to go to Des Moines

Des Moines exper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 21.7°F (-5.7°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 74.8°F (23.8°C). May is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Des Moines, April, June, and July are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
